Even if he'd had had time to react to the sudden appearance of that torrent of water that came from the beast, it would have done him little good. As it was, it was within seconds of its appearance that he was literally picked up and tossed down the hall he'd come down not too long ago. He lost hold of the shotgun between the initial throw and the unkind landing, but he maintained his death grip on the stone he held.
Coughing what water he'd swallowed up, he looked up toward the direction he'd come from through soaked and clinging blond hair. With that between him and the two viable ground exits that he knew of, he was strained in the way of any retreat which wouldn't run the risk of him injuring himself further on its use. Even if he hadn't lost the damn gun, it would be useless to him as soaked as it no doubt would be by now.
If it wasn't for the fact it was a waste of precious breath, he'd curse the situation soundly. No chance of anyone coming by in the last minute and providing a reprieve either. The unexpected warmth coming from the stone he held so tightly distracted his thoughts and his watch for either more water or the demon following him down the hall. Opening the clenched hand to eye the stone he noted absently the pointed end at the top had broke the skin of his palm due to him holding it so tight, but he didn't think that was the cause of the sudden warmth. It was also glowing about as brightly as it had previously when he'd confronted the thing down the hall, a fact which made him give that direct another quick look.
"God Stone bearer, with me now do treat."
Well. That was unexpected. If it hadn't been for the obvious difference in the voice which spoke, he'd almost think the demon which had attacked him had spoken in another bid for the stone.
"Your spirit and my flesh as one shall merge. Life undying yours forevermore."
"What's the catch?" The words were sarcastic, if a little low and rough sounding. He didn't really expect a reply to the question and even if one had come, he likely would have missed it as his attention shifted from the stone now fairly hoovering over the open palm to the sound of moving chain and something else heavier coming down the hall toward him.
"Your resentment and wrath, their call I heed. And so once more I ask: With me do treat."
It was possible in a manner of thinking that this was how one actually accessed the power the stone was said to have. Which was the entire reason he'd desired to keep the thing in the first place...and also why he was currently listening to something which fully intended to kill him, and seemed rather capable of actually doing it, in order to claim it.
In other words he had pretty much everything to lose if he refused and possibly much to gain if he accepted. Not exactly a hard choice in this situation. "Yes, I'll 'treat' with you."
"Adrammelech, the Wroth,have I been named. Your plea to answer now my only wish."
With little to no warning to the lone other figure in the hall, Famfrit's destination was suddenly filled with a near blinding emerald light, blotting out the sight of the young man who had been kneeling on the floor.
